What is Digital Marketing?

Digital marketing is the practice of promoting products, services, or brands through various digital channels such as search engines, social media, email, mobile apps, and websites. The goal of digital marketing is to reach potential customers where they spend their time online and to engage with them in a meaningful way.

Digital marketing has become increasingly important in today's digital age, as more and more people are turning to the internet to research products and services before making a purchase. With the right digital marketing strategy, businesses can reach their target audience more effectively and convert leads into customers. Digital marketing also allows for greater measurement and tracking of campaign performance, making it easier to optimize and refine marketing efforts over time. Overall, digital marketing is an essential component of any modern marketing strategy and can provide businesses with a competitive edge in today's digital marketplace.
